Applicant's summary and conclusion

Conclusions:
The Log Pow of the test substance is -0.31 at 23°C.
Executive summary:

The partition coefficient n-octanol/water was determiend according to OECD 107 with the shake flask method. 10, 20 and 40 ml of a stock solution in water saturated n-octanol was shaken with 20 ml water (in duplicate) at 23 °C and the concentration of the test substance was determiend by UV-vis-spectroscopy.
